こんにちわ、太治奨揮です!
「エンジニアになりたいけど、何から始めればいいのか分からない」
「プログラミングは始めたけど、成長している実感がない」
そんな悩みを持つ初心者エンジニアに向けて、実際に多くの現場で成果を出してきた方法を5つ紹介します。順番に取り組むことで、確実にスキルアップが実感できます。
1. 小さなアプリを自分で作る
学習サイトのチュートリアルだけでは、実戦的な力はつきません。おすすめは、自分でテーマを決めて小さなアプリを作ることです。
たとえば、
- TODOリスト
- 天気情報表示アプリ
- APIを叩いて表示する簡易検索ツール
など、自分が使いたいものを実装してみましょう。小さな「完成」を積み重ねることで、確かな技術力と自信が身につきます。
2. GitHubでコードを公開する
学んだことをGitHubにアップしておくと、他の人の目に触れることで意識も高まりますし、転職や案件獲得時のポートフォリオとしても活用できます。
「とにかくキレイに仕上げなきゃ」と思わず、まずは記録のように使ってOK。少しずつ改善していく中で、コードの質も自然に上がります。
3. 現役エンジニアとつながる
独学は孤独になりがちです。そんなときこそ、コミュニティへの参加やSNSでの発信が有効です。
おすすめは:
- TwitterやXで「#駆け出しエンジニア」と検索
- DiscordやSlackの技術系コミュニティに参加
- オンライン勉強会(connpassやQiitaイベントなど)
他の人のコードや学びを見るだけでも刺激になります。
4. 実務経験を早めに積む
「まだスキルが不十分だから実務はまだ早い」と思いがちですが、実は逆です。実務経験こそ最強の教材です。
たとえば、
- クラウドソーシングで簡単な案件を受けてみる
- 無償で知人のWebサイト制作を請け負う
- インターンに応募する
など、小さな一歩からでOKです。実務を通して、技術・納期・コミュニケーション力が一気に育ちます。
5. 毎日30分でも継続する
最後に大切なのは、「とにかく継続」です。1日30分でもいいので、毎日コードに触れる習慣をつけること。量が質を生み出し、継続が自信に変わります。
ToDoアプリの改善でも、Udemyの講座視聴でも、ブログ執筆でも構いません。「毎日学ぶ」こと自体が、未来の自分を作ってくれます。
まとめ
初心者エンジニアがスキルアップするためには、以下の5つの方法が効果的です。
- 小さなアプリを自作する
- GitHubでコードを公開する
- 現役エンジニアとつながる
- 実務経験を早めに積む
- 毎日30分の学習を継続する
最初は不安でも、一歩一歩の積み重ねがあなたを確実に一流エンジニアへと導いてくれます。ぜひ、今日から実践してみてください!
ご希望があれば、ここからスライド資料やSNS向けに短縮したまとめ投稿も作成可能です。お気軽にご相談ください。